New York – (May 4, 2015) – OTC Global Holdings (OTCGH), the leading independent commodities interdealer broker, announced the formation of Elite Metals.

The new desk, based out of New York and part of OTCGH subsidiary company Elite Brokers, will concentrate on broking over the counter options and futures on precious metals. It will operate as a boutique options brokerage serving hedge funds, investment banks, commodity trading houses and corporations.

“I’m incredibly excited to have joined OTC Global Holdings,” said Mike Rodgers, head of Elite Metals. “The corporate culture here is refreshing and management’s commitment to excellence is unwavering, despite challenging commodity market conditions, regulatory uncertainty and continued pressure on our clients. We have heaps of hard work to do, but with a flexible operating model and my colleague Paul Westney as the brains of this operation I’m sure we can accomplish tremendous things for this company.”

Originally from Northern Ireland, Rodgers is a former barrister and equity derivatives broker. In late 2011, he moved into commodities, which allowed him the opportunity to start broking precious metals. Joining him on the desk is Westney, who will assist in the development of a precious metals brokerage presence. Prior to joining OTC Global Holdings, he was a commodities trader with Merrill Lynch Commodities, Inc., and a hedge fund in New York.

“There has been an industry wide drive towards transparency and cleared products, and we believe this will only grow in the years ahead,” said Joe Kelly, president and COO, OTCGH. “I look forward to seeing how Mike and Paul and their team collaborate with our other brokerages in New York and across the globe.”


About OTC Global Holdings LP

Formed in 2007, OTC Global Holdings has become the world’s largest independent institutional broker of commodities, covering financial and physical instruments from offices in Chicago, Geneva, Houston, New Jersey, London, Louisville and New York.  The company is a leading liquidity provider on CBOT, ICE and NYMEX, ranking number one amongst its peers in numerous derivatives contracts across biofuels, emissions, commodity index products, crude oil, natural gas, natural gas liquids (NGLs), metals, petrochemicals and refined products, power, proppants, soft commodities, and weather derivatives.  The company serves more than 450 institutional clients, including over 70 members of the Global Fortune 500, and transacts in hundreds of different commodity delivery points in Asia, Europe and the Americas.
